The final choice balances budget, personal charging habits, and a desire for future-ready technology.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">What Exactly is a &#8216;Smart&#8217; Charging Box?<\/h2>\n\n\n\n<figure class=\"wp-block-image aligncenter size-large\"><img decoding=\"async\" width=\"1200\" height=\"675\" src=\"https:\/\/tpsonpower.com\/wp-content\/uploads\/2025\/12\/70f0fa6212874ef2b3df0445f28d1db4.webp\" alt=\"Tam Olarak Nedir \" class=\"wp-image-3072\" title=\"\" srcset=\"https:\/\/tpsonpower.com\/wp-content\/uploads\/2025\/12\/70f0fa6212874ef2b3df0445f28d1db4.webp 1200w, https:\/\/tpsonpower.com\/wp-content\/uploads\/2025\/12\/70f0fa6212874ef2b3df0445f28d1db4-300x169.webp 300w, https:\/\/tpsonpower.com\/wp-content\/uploads\/2025\/12\/70f0fa6212874ef2b3df0445f28d1db4-1024x576.webp 1024w, https:\/\/tpsonpower.com\/wp-content\/uploads\/2025\/12\/70f0fa6212874ef2b3df0445f28d1db4-768x432.webp 768w, https:\/\/tpsonpower.com\/wp-content\/uploads\/2025\/12\/70f0fa6212874ef2b3df0445f28d1db4-18x10.webp 18w\" sizes=\"(max-width: 1200px) 100vw, 1200px\" \/><figcaption><\/figcaption><\/figure>\n\n\n\n<p>Before weighing the pros and cons, it is crucial to understand what separates a smart charging box from a standard, or &#8220;dumb,&#8221; charger. The difference lies in connectivity and intelligence. A standard charger simply delivers electricity, much like a wall socket. A smart charger, however, <a href=\"https:\/\/powerverse.com\/whats-a-smart-ev-charger-2\/\" rel=\"nofollow noopener\" target=\"_blank\">includes a data connection<\/a> that unlocks a host of <a href=\"https:\/\/tpsonpower.com\/best-ev-chargers-features-for-home-efficiency-safety\/\">geli\u0307\u015fmi\u0307\u015f yetenekler<\/a>.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Smart vs. &#8216;Dumb&#8217; Chargers: The Key Differences<\/h3>\n\n\n\n<h4 class=\"wp-block-heading\">Connectivity and App Control<\/h4>\n\n\n\n<p>The most significant distinction is communication. A smart charger connects to your home&#8217;s Wi-Fi or Bluetooth network. This connection enables <a href=\"https:\/\/www.kia.com\/uk\/about\/news\/what-is-smart-ev-charging\/\" rel=\"nofollow noopener\" target=\"_blank\">remote control through a smartphone app<\/a>. Users can start, stop, and monitor charging sessions from anywhere. A standard charger lacks this feature, operating only when a vehicle is physically plugged in.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">\u00c7izelgeleme ve Otomasyon<\/h4>\n\n\n\n<p>Smart chargers empower users to automate their charging routines. An owner can <a href=\"https:\/\/www.ovoenergy.com\/guides\/energy-guides\/ev-smart-charging-explained-benefits-and-types\" rel=\"nofollow noopener\" target=\"_blank\">schedule charging to begin during specific hours<\/a>, such as late at night. This feature is a core component of managing energy costs. Standard chargers do not offer scheduling; they begin delivering power the moment they are connected.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">G\u00fc\u00e7 \u00c7\u0131k\u0131\u015f\u0131 ve \u015earj H\u0131z\u0131<\/h4>\n\n\n\n<p>Both smart and standard chargers are available in various power levels (e.g., 7kW, 22kW), which determine the maximum charging speed. However, a smart charger provides granular control over the energy output. It can adjust the power flow based on household demand or user settings, which helps protect the vehicle&#8217;s battery.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">G\u00fcvenlik ve Sertifikasyon Standartlar\u0131<\/h4>\n\n\n\n<p>All reputable chargers sold in Colombia must meet strict safety certifications. Advanced providers like TPSON ensure their products comply with international standards. Smart chargers add another layer of safety with features like <a href=\"https:\/\/thefullev.co.uk\/open-charge-point-protocol-explained\/\" rel=\"nofollow noopener\" target=\"_blank\">dinamik y\u00fck dengeleme<\/a>, which actively prevents overloading a home&#8217;s electrical circuit.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">How Smart Charging Technology Works<\/h3>\n\n\n\n<p>The &#8220;smart&#8221; functionality relies on a seamless flow of information between the charger, the vehicle, and the user.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">The Role of Wi-Fi and Bluetooth<\/h4>\n\n\n\n<p>Wireless connectivity is the backbone of a smart charger. Wi-Fi connects the device to the internet, allowing it to communicate with a cloud-based platform and the user&#8217;s smartphone app. This enables remote commands and data reporting.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Communication with Your EV<\/h4>\n\n\n\n<p>When an EV is connected, the charger and vehicle begin a digital handshake. The system authenticates the vehicle and authorizes the session. Throughout the process, the charger sends real-time data, including the battery status and energy consumption, to a central management system. This constant data exchange ensures a reliable and efficient transfer of energy to the car&#8217;s battery.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Over-the-Air (OTA) Software Updates<\/h4>\n\n\n\n<p>An internet-connected charger can receive software updates directly from the manufacturer. These OTA updates can introduce new features, improve battery charging algorithms, and enhance security, ensuring the device remains effective and up-to-date.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Data Collection and Reporting<\/h4>\n\n\n\n<p>A smart charger meticulously tracks every charging session. It records the amount of energy consumed, the duration of the charge, and the associated costs. This device gives owners precise control over when and how they use electricity, directly impacting their monthly bills and maximizing their return on investment.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Understanding Time-of-Use (TOU) Tariffs in Colombia<\/h4>\n\n\n\n<p>Some Colombian utility companies offer Time-of-Use (TOU) or variable-rate tariffs. These plans charge different prices for electricity depending on the time of day. Energy is typically most expensive during peak hours (late afternoon and early evening) and cheapest during off-peak hours (late at night). A smart charger is the key to unlocking these savings.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">How Smart Scheduling Maximizes Savings<\/h4>\n\n\n\n<p>Smart scheduling is the core feature for cost reduction. An owner can use a smartphone app to program the charger to operate only during off-peak hours. The vehicle is plugged in when the owner gets home, but the charger waits until the <a href=\"https:\/\/evonestop.co.uk\/blogs\/news\/qubev-smart-electric-car-charger-for-home\" rel=\"nofollow noopener\" target=\"_blank\">cheaper electricity rates<\/a> begin. This simple automation ensures the car&#8217;s battery is full by morning at the lowest possible cost, generating significant savings over time.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Real-World Savings Examples<\/h4>\n\n\n\n<p>Consider a household on a variable-rate plan. This data helps them understand their EV&#8217;s impact on their total household energy usage and identify further opportunities for savings.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Pro 2: Enhance Safety and Protect Your Home&#8217;s Electrical System<\/h3>\n\n\n\n<p>Beyond cost, safety is a paramount concern. <a href=\"https:\/\/tpsonpower.com\/\">Advanced chargers from providers like TPSON<\/a> incorporate intelligent features designed to protect not only the vehicle but also the home&#8217;s entire electrical infrastructure.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Dinamik Y\u00fck Dengeleme Nedir?<\/h4>\n\n\n\n<p><a href=\"https:\/\/in.solaxpower.com\/ev-chargers.html\" rel=\"nofollow noopener\" target=\"_blank\">Dinamik y\u00fck dengeleme<\/a> is a crucial safety feature. A smart charger with this function constantly monitors the total electricity being used in a home. If it detects that the household&#8217;s energy consumption is nearing its maximum capacity (for example, when the oven, air conditioning, and shower are all running), it automatically reduces the charging power to the EV. This mechanism ensures safe and efficient charging while actively preventing electrical overloads.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Preventing Circuit Overloads in Colombian Homes<\/h4>\n\n\n\n<p>Many Colombian homes, especially older ones, were not built to handle the high, sustained load of an EV charger plus other major appliances. A standard charger running at full power could easily trip a circuit breaker or, in worse cases, cause damage. Dynamic load balancing automatically adjusts the charging power according to the household&#8217;s electricity capacity, making it a vital feature for avoiding these dangerous overloads.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Protecting Your EV&#8217;s Battery Health<\/h4>\n\n\n\n<p>A healthy battery is essential for a long-lasting EV. If those rates are not available, the payback period for the higher initial cost could be very long or even nonexistent.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Con 2: The Reality of Colombian Electricity Tariffs<\/h3>\n\n\n\n<p>The primary financial benefit of a smart charger\u2014scheduling charges for cheaper off-peak hours\u2014is not a universal advantage in Colombia. The structure of the country&#8217;s electricity billing system can render this key feature ineffective for many households.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Limited Availability of Variable Rates by Utility<\/h4>\n\n\n\n<p>Time-of-Use (TOU) or variable-rate electricity plans are not standard across all utility providers in Colombia. Many regions and providers operate on a flat-rate system, where the cost per kilowatt-hour (kWh) remains the same 24 hours a day. In this scenario, scheduling a charge for 2:00 AM provides no financial benefit over charging at 7:00 PM.<\/p>\n\n\n\n<blockquote class=\"wp-block-quote is-layout-flow wp-block-quote-is-layout-flow\">\n<p><strong>\u0130pucu<\/strong>: Before purchasing any charger, check your monthly electricity bill or contact your utility provider (e.g., EPM, Enel-Codensa, Celsia) directly. Ask them explicitly if they offer variable or Time-of-Use tariffs for residential customers.<\/p>\n<\/blockquote>\n\n\n\n<h4 class=\"wp-block-heading\">How to Check Your Utility Provider&#8217;s Tariff Structure<\/h4>\n\n\n\n<p>Understanding your billing is simple. Your electricity bill (<code>electricity bill<\/code>) details the rate structure. Look for terms like <code>hourly rate<\/code> (hourly rate) or different prices for <code>peak<\/code> (peak) and <code>off-peak<\/code> (off-peak) periods. If your bill only shows a single <code>kWh ba\u015f\u0131na maliyet<\/code>, you are likely on a flat-rate plan.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">How the &#8216;Estrato&#8217; System Impacts Flat-Rate Billing<\/h4>\n\n\n\n<p><a href=\"https:\/\/en.wikipedia.org\/wiki\/Estrato\" rel=\"nofollow noopener\" target=\"_blank\">Colombia&#8217;s socioeconomic stratification system, known as &#8216;socioeconomic strata&#8217;<\/a>, heavily influences utility costs. This system often reinforces flat-rate billing structures. Properties are classified from 1 (lowest income) to 6 (highest income), which determines subsidies or surcharges on the base energy cost.<\/p>\n\n\n\n<figure class=\"wp-block-table\"><table class=\"has-fixed-layout\"><thead><tr><th>Estrato<\/th><th>Socioeconomic Level<\/th><th>Electricity Billing Impact<\/th><\/tr><\/thead><tbody><tr><td>1<\/td><td>Low-low<\/td><td>Receives subsidies<\/td><\/tr><tr><td>2<\/td><td>D\u00fc\u015f\u00fck<\/td><td>Receives subsidies<\/td><\/tr><tr><td>3<\/td><td>Medium-low<\/td><td>Receives subsidies<\/td><\/tr><tr><td>4<\/td><td>Orta<\/td><td>Pays full cost<\/td><\/tr><tr><td>5<\/td><td>Medium-high<\/td><td>Pays surcharges to subsidize lower socioeconomic strata<\/td><\/tr><tr><td>6<\/td><td>Y\u00fcksek<\/td><td>Pays surcharges to subsidize lower socioeconomic strata<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<p>This system focuses on social equity rather than demand management. As a result, the final price per kWh is often a fixed amount adjusted for the estrato, not for the time of day the energy is consumed.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">When a Smart Charger&#8217;s Main Feature is Ineffective<\/h4>\n\n\n\n<p>The conclusion is straightforward. If your household is on a flat-rate electricity plan, the primary cost-saving feature of a smart charger is completely nullified. You cannot save money by shifting your energy consumption to off-peak hours if those hours do not exist in your billing structure. The investment in smart scheduling capabilities would yield no financial return.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Con 3: A Standard &#8216;Dumb&#8217; Charger Is Often Good Enough<\/h3>\n\n\n\n<p>For many EV owners, the core need is simple: to replenish the car&#8217;s battery safely and reliably. For individuals who prefer technology that just works without configuration, this &#8220;plug and charge&#8221; approach is ideal.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">When Your EV Already Has Built-in Charging Controls<\/h4>\n\n\n\n<p>Many modern electric vehicles come equipped with their own onboard charging schedulers. Owners can use the car&#8217;s infotainment system or its companion smartphone app to set charging start and stop times. If your vehicle already has this capability, it makes the scheduling feature of a smart charger redundant. You can achieve the same result\u2014timed charging\u2014without the extra expense of a smart wallbox.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">If Your Daily Commute is Short and Consistent<\/h4>\n\n\n\n<p>Consider your driving habits. For some owners, managing this technology can feel more like a hassle than a benefit.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">The Need for a Stable Wi-Fi Signal in Your Garage<\/h4>\n\n\n\n<p>A smart charger&#8217;s intelligence is powered by its internet connection. Without a strong, stable Wi-Fi signal, it effectively becomes a &#8220;dumb&#8221; charger with a higher price tag. Many Colombian homes have garages or parking spaces located far from the main internet router. Concrete walls and floors often block or weaken the signal, making a reliable connection difficult to achieve.<\/p>\n\n\n\n<blockquote class=\"wp-block-quote is-layout-flow wp-block-quote-is-layout-flow\">\n<p><strong>Signal Check!<\/strong> \ud83d\udcf6<br>Before buying a smart charger, an owner should take their smartphone to the exact spot where the charger will be installed. They must check if a strong and consistent Wi-Fi signal is available. If the signal is weak or nonexistent, they will need to invest in a Wi-Fi extender or a mesh network system, adding another layer of cost and technical setup.<\/p>\n<\/blockquote>\n\n\n\n<h4 class=\"wp-block-heading\">Dealing with App Glitches and Updates<\/h4>\n\n\n\n<p>Smart chargers operate using complex software, both on the device itself (firmware) and on the owner&#8217;s smartphone (the app).
